Abstract

World population growth has raised demand for agricultural production, leading to intensive farming practices. To boost productivity and meet food requirements, antibiotics have been extensively used in both animal husbandry and crop production. However, the widespread use of agricultural antibiotics has polluted the environment, posing risks to ecosystems and human health. Soil serves as the primary sink for agricultural antibiotics, accumulating them mainly through direct excretion by livestock and the application of animal manure. Depending on their physicochemical properties, agricultural antibiotics may also leach into water systems. Once released into the environment, they could disrupt native microbial communities and facilitate the spread of antibiotic-resistance genes. They could also affect key soil processes by suppressing microbial activities and inhibiting enzyme function, thereby reducing soil fertility and ecosystem functioning. Furthermore, antibiotic-resistant bacteria could enter the food chain and be transmitted to humans, threatening our health. Therefore, environmental surveillance is essential for monitoring contamination levels of agricultural antibiotics and resistance genes. Ultimately, improving management strategies for antibiotic use and waste treatment is crucial to minimize exposure and thus protect human health.
